Output d0e8fe5abcbc009b76a1ffa5454f4993acee616d60d8fda18ce9fbfb9d01bc04:3

value
887936
script pubkey
OP_0 OP_PUSHBYTES_20 71337c6a89126ea7b5ef1288aa89e9a4a2153cd6
address
bc1qwyehc65fzfh20d00z2y24z0f5j3p20xkuqwsnp
transaction
d0e8fe5abcbc009b76a1ffa5454f4993acee616d60d8fda18ce9fbfb9d01bc04
confirmations
577
spent
true